Home » cybersecurity » Remote: Support For Password Authentication Was Removed On

Remote: Support For Password Authentication Was Removed On

If you’ve recently encountered the error “Support for password authentication was removed. Please use a personal access token instead” while pushing code to your GitHub repository, you’re not alone. This change, implemented by GitHub since August 13, 2021, marks a significant shift in how users authenticate Git operations. This article guides you through creating and using a Personal Access Token (PAT) as a replacement for password authentication.

Remote password authentication is an important tool for keeping our digital assets secure, so you can image the shock of many users when they heard about the news that support for remote password authentication had been removed. The announcement caused concern among individuals and businesses who heavily rely on the same for IT system security. This article is an attempt to explain the reason behind the removal of remote password authentication support and suggest the necessary alternatives that can be implemented to maintain the same level of security. So, if you are looking to understand why remote password authentication support was removed and explore available options to replace this important security feature, then keep reading.

Understanding the Change:

GitHub’s decision to replace password authentication with PATs aims to enhance security. PATs offer more control and are considered more secure than traditional passwords, especially for Git operations.

1. What is Remote Password Authentication?

Remote Password Authentication is a form of digital identification that enables users to access various systems from any web-connected device. It requires the authentication of the user’s identity through a password or PIN. Remote Password Authentication is a key component of secure networks, and it helps ensure that only the right people are accessing confidential data.

Here are some advantages Remote Password Authentication offers:

  • Strong security: strong authentication methods are in place to ensure your data remains safe and secure.
  • Cost-effective: remote password authentication typically requires minimal setup, so there are few costs associated with it.
  • Ease of use: most users find it easy to use and set up, allowing for quick access to data.

2. How Does it Help Secure Your Device?

In order to keep your device safe, it is important to equip it with the right security measures. These security measures can help protect your device and all the information stored on it from hackers, malware, and other online threats. Here are some of the ways in which it can help secure your device:

  • Firewalls: These are security barriers that monitor and block network traffic coming and going from your device.
  • Virus protection and malware scanning: These types of security measures can search for any malicious programs that may be installed on your device and alert you to take action before any data is compromised.
  • Encryption: Encryption technology scrambles data so that if any of it is intercepted, it would be unreadable and unable to be used by hackers.
  • Private networks: Creating private networks for your device can help limit access to your device and the information stored on it.

The combination of these security measures can help ensure that your device and the information stored on it is safe from any potential threats. However, it is important to keep your security measures up-to-date in order to stay one step ahead of any potential risk.

3. Why Was Password Authentication Removed for Remote?

Password authentication was removed as the primary means for remote authentication due to its vulnerability to attack. Passwords can be stolen, guessed, or easily cracked by hackers. This lack of security threatens the safety of data and systems.

Authentication methods such as using tokens or biometrics have been employed to provide a more secure form of authentication. They are far more difficult to crack. Tokens use a unique identifier that changes with time, making them difficult to spoof. Biometrics also provide a higher level of authentication, verifying identity by means of a fingerprint, iris scan, or other identifier.

  • Passwords are vulnerable to attack.
  • Tokens use a unique identifier that changes with time.
  • Biometrics verify identity by fingerprint, iris scan, or other identifier.

4. Creating a Personal Access Token

Here’s a step-by-step guide to creating your PAT:

  • Step 1: Access your GitHub account settings by clicking on your profile and selecting ‘Settings’.
  • Step 2: Navigate to ‘Developer Settings’ from the sidebar.
  • Step 3: Select ‘Personal access tokens’, then ‘Tokens (classic)’.
  • Step 4: Choose ‘Generate new token’ followed by ‘Generate new token (classic)’.
  • Step 5: Complete the ‘Note’ field, select ‘No expiration’, and choose appropriate permissions for your token.
  • Step 6: Generate the token and ensure to copy it; this is the only time it will be displayed.
  • Step 7: Use the copied token as your password in the terminal during Git operations.

Successfully Pushing Code with PAT:

Once your PAT is set up, you can use it in place of a password. This allows seamless pushing of code to your GitHub repository, ensuring enhanced security for your Git operations.

Troubleshooting Common Issues:

Despite the straightforward process, some users might face errors even after applying the PAT. For solutions to these common issues, refer to the blog here, particularly “Error 3 Solution 1”.

Community Feedback:

Community feedback has been positive and they have expressed gratitude for the guidance provided in navigating this new authentication process, highlighting the importance and utility of such instructions.

Q&A

Q: What is remote and why was support for password authentication removed?
A: Remote is a way for you to access programs or files from a different computer. Support for password authentication was removed to improve the security of Remote and help keep your data safe.

Conclusion

The transition to Personal Access Tokens on GitHub is a pivotal step towards more robust security in code management. By following these steps, developers can adapt to these changes efficiently, ensuring their repositories remain secure and accessible. Happy coding! The solution to this issue is simple – create a FREE LogMeOnce account. LogMeOnce is one of the leading password management solutions, offering comprehensive and secure features that protect all users’ passwords. LogMeOnce offers various powerful tools such as a secure Password Generator and Password Score so users can manage remote: support for password authentication needs with one-click security. By creating a FREE account, you can easily and securely manage remote: support for password authentication without any worries.

Search

Category

Protect your passwords, for FREE

How convenient can passwords be? Download LogMeOnce Password Manager for FREE now and be more secure than ever.